This fixture exercises the new resolver path: it pins
// the compiler snapshot, disables network fetches, and validates
// that the sandbox manifest matches the lockfile. If the checksum
// drift test fails, regenerate the manifest with `qb regen` before
// re-running. The fixture authenticates against the staging artifact
// cache, so reviewers should confirm the credential below is the
// staging one, not production. The token used for cache access is:

portal login ticket: eyJhbGciOiJIUzI1NiIsInR5cCI6IkpXVCJ9.eyJzdWIiOiIwEOsktwVNwIn0.-UJU3fdyyCgG

## Log sampling: chirpd

chirpd emits ~40k log lines/min at INFO. We sample. Defaults: 1% INFO, 10% WARN, 100% ERROR, set in `sampling.yaml`. Don't raise INFO sampling without approval — storage costs spike fast. Debug sessions: use the `--trace-id` override to capture a single request unsampled. Changes go through the normal PR flow on the Fernwhistle repo. Questions about sampling rules or temporary overrides go to the observability crew at the address below.

alerts address for bajop-yahog: istwyn@lumiclabs.internal

Handover: Lumora consent banner rollout. Phase 2 ships behind the `cb_v2` flag; ramp is at 25% in Nordia region only. Legal sign-off covers EU copy, not the APAC variant — hold that. If opt-out rates spike above 12%, freeze the ramp and ping Dario. Rollback is one flag flip. Full rollout checklist and regional copy matrix are on the internal page.

operations page: https://jira.qirvansys.internal/display/dash/dash/2ffa8a097d16